清除浮动

来源:互联网 发布:国债逆回购 知乎 编辑:程序博客网 时间:2024/05/22 00:26
.clearfix{zoom:1}

这是专门为IE的老版本所写的,为了兼容。

.clearfix:after{    content:"";    display:block;    visibility:hidden;    height:0;    clear:both;}

伪对象选择符:在这个对象被浏览器渲染后添加一定的内容(content的值)
content必须写;
display将其转换为块级元素;
visibility为可视化属性,控制元素是否可见,但不管是否可见都将保留其物理空间(与display:none不同);
height指定content的高度,目前高度为0则表示不占用高度,也就是说不显示内容;
clear:both将添加进去的内容作为清楚浮动的对象,实现外围容器中有内容存在,因此可以自动判别高度,解决塌陷。

原创粉丝点击